본문 바로가기

cs지식

도커와 vm

vm이란 컴퓨터(os깔려있는)를 소프트웨어로 구현

 

하이퍼바이저: 여러개의 os를 실행하기 위한 플랫폼

 

도커: 개발한 환경들과 코드를 묶어서 이미지로 만들어서 다른 컴퓨터에서도 쉽게 개발한 컴퓨터의 환경으로 설정 가능

 

 도커와 vm 창점 : docker는 호스트os위에 이미지만 올리면 되는데 vm은 호스트os 위에 guestos를  만들어서 그 위에서 실행